版权所有:内蒙古大学图书馆 技术提供:维普资讯• 智图
内蒙古自治区呼和浩特市赛罕区大学西街235号 邮编: 010021
作者机构:Free Univ Amsterdam Dept Comp Sci NL-1081 HV Amsterdam Netherlands
出 版 物:《CONCURRENCY-PRACTICE AND EXPERIENCE》 (并行学和计算:实践与经验)
年 卷 期:2000年第12卷第8期
页 面:643-666页
核心收录:
学科分类:08[工学] 0835[工学-软件工程] 0812[工学-计算机科学与技术(可授工学、理学学位)]
主 题:Java RMI metacomputing parallel programming
摘 要:Java s support for parallel and distributed processing makes the language attractive for metacomputing applications, such as parallel applications that run on geographically distributed (wide-area) systems. To obtain actual experience with a Java-centric approach to metacomputing, we have built and used a highperformance wide-area Java system, called Manta, Manta implements the Java Remote Method Invocation (RMI) model using different communication protocols (active messages and TCP/IP) for different networks. The paper shows how wide-area parallel applications can be expressed and optimized using Java RMI, Also, it presents performance results of several applications on a wide-area system consisting of four Myrinet-based clusters connected by ATM WANs, We finally discuss alternative programming models, namely object replication, JavaSpaces, and MPI for Java, Copyright (C) 2000 John Wiley & Sons, Ltd.